Payback period is the time until cumulative net cash flow turns positive. Simple payback ignores the time value of money; discounted payback applies your cost of capital first and is always longer. In industrial procurement, under four years is generally treated as fast, four to seven years as normal for heavy assets, and beyond seven years as requiring board and lender scrutiny.

How it is calculated
net = gross benefit − operating cost; simple payback = investment ÷ net; NPV = Σ CFt ÷ (1+r)^t with CF0 = −investment; IRR = r where NPV = 0; lifetime ROI = (net × life + residual − investment) ÷ investment.

What is not included
- Simple payback ignores the time value of money and must not be read as a return.
- IRR is undefined for series without a sign change and unreliable for series with multiple sign changes.
- Does not model financing cost, tax, inflation or currency risk.
- Single-currency model. All inputs must be entered in one currency; no exchange-rate conversion or inflation indexation is applied.
- Pre-tax model. Corporate tax, depreciation shields and local incentives are excluded and must be assessed by a qualified accountant.

Frequently asked questions
What is the difference between simple and discounted payback?+
Simple payback adds nominal cash flows until they cover the investment. Discounted payback discounts each year at the cost of capital first, so it is always longer and closer to economic reality.
Is payback enough to approve CAPEX?+
No. Payback ignores everything after break-even, so pair it with NPV and IRR before a final investment decision.
What payback period is acceptable?+
It depends on asset life and sector: automation and retrofits are often expected under three years, while plant and cold-chain infrastructure commonly runs five to eight years.
